arbalest
Meanings
Plural: arbalests
Noun
- an engine that provided medieval artillery used during sieges; a heavy war engine for hurling large stones and other missiles
- A steel crossbow.
- A crossbowman who uses an arbalest.
Origin / Etymology
From Middle English arblast, from Old French arbaleste (modern arbalète), from Late Latin arcuballista, from Latin arcus + ballista.
